网站如何接入小程序

网站接入小程序需先注册微信小程序账号,获取AppID。接着,开发者在网站后台嵌入小程序API,配置服务器域名,确保HTTPS支持。利用微信提供的开发工具进行代码编写,实现网站与小程序的数据交互。最后,提交审核并发布,确保用户体验流畅。

imagesource from: pexels

网站如何接入小程序

随着移动互联网的快速发展,小程序凭借其便捷性和易用性,已成为企业提升用户体验、拓展业务的重要手段。本文将详细介绍网站接入小程序的重要性和意义,并概述接入流程的基本步骤,激发读者对具体操作细节的兴趣。通过深入了解网站接入小程序的每一个环节,您将能够更好地把握这一趋势,为您的企业提供更多价值。

一、注册微信小程序账号

  1. 注册流程及注意事项

    注册微信小程序账号是网站接入小程序的第一步,其流程如下:

    • 访问微信公众平台,选择“立即注册”。
    • 选择主体类型,如个人或企业。
    • 填写相关信息,包括主体信息、管理员信息等。
    • 验证手机号码和邮箱。
    • 确认并提交注册信息。

    在注册过程中,请注意以下几点:

    • 选择合适的主体类型,以便后续功能的使用。
    • 确保手机号码和邮箱的准确性,以便接收验证码和通知。
    • 遵循微信公众平台的相关规定,如实填写信息。
  2. 获取AppID及其重要性

    注册成功后,您将获得一个AppID,它是微信小程序的唯一标识符,用于小程序的调试、发布和运营。以下是AppID的重要性:

    • 调试与发布:AppID是小程序调试和发布的必要条件。
    • 数据分析:AppID可用于统计和分析小程序的数据,帮助您了解用户行为和优化小程序。
    • 权限管理:AppID用于管理小程序的权限,如第三方平台接入等。

    在使用AppID时,请注意保管好相关密码,防止他人非法使用。

二、嵌入小程序API

1、选择合适的小程序API

选择合适的小程序API是确保网站与小程序无缝对接的关键。以下是一些常见的小程序API及其用途:

API名称 用途
wx.login 获取用户登录凭证
wx.getUserInfo 获取用户信息
wx.chooseImage 选择图片
wx.previewImage 预览图片
wx.shareAppMessage 分享小程序

在选择API时,应考虑以下因素:

  • 功能需求:根据网站功能需求,选择合适的API。
  • 用户体验:选择易于使用的API,提高用户体验。
  • 安全性:选择安全可靠的API,保护用户隐私。

2、在网站后台嵌入API的步骤

以下是在网站后台嵌入API的基本步骤:

  1. 获取API接口地址:在微信小程序后台,找到对应API的接口地址。
  2. 配置API接口地址:在网站后台,将API接口地址配置到相应的位置。
  3. 调用API接口:在网站代码中,调用API接口,实现所需功能。

3、常见问题及解决方案

问题 解决方案
API调用失败 检查API接口地址是否正确,网络连接是否正常
用户信息获取失败 检查用户是否已登录,API接口权限是否正确
图片选择失败 检查API接口权限,确保用户有选择图片的权限

通过以上步骤,您可以在网站中嵌入小程序API,实现网站与小程序的联动。在实际操作过程中,遇到问题时,可根据以上解决方案进行排查。

三、配置服务器域名

1. 服务器域名配置方法

在网站接入小程序的过程中,配置服务器域名是关键的一环。以下是配置服务器域名的具体方法:

  1. 登录微信公众平台,选择对应的小程序。
  2. 进入“设置”-“服务器域名”页面。
  3. 点击“添加服务器域名”,填写域名信息。
  4. 提交后,等待微信公众平台审核。

2. 确保HTTPS支持的重要性

HTTPS支持是现代网站的基本要求。确保你的服务器域名支持HTTPS,有以下重要意义:

  • 增强用户信任感,提升用户体验。
  • 保护用户隐私,防止数据泄露。
  • 提升搜索引擎排名,有利于网站SEO。

3. 域名配置常见问题

在配置服务器域名时,可能会遇到以下常见问题:

  1. 域名未解析:确保域名已解析到你的服务器IP地址。
  2. DNS设置错误:检查DNS设置是否正确,包括A记录和CNAME记录。
  3. HTTPS不支持:确保服务器支持HTTPS,并开启SSL证书。

以下是一个简单的表格,对比了域名配置成功的特征与失败的特征:

特征 域名配置成功 域名配置失败
域名解析成功 域名指向正确IP地址 域名解析失败,返回错误信息
DNS设置正确 A记录和CNAME记录配置正确 A记录或CNAME记录错误
HTTPS支持 服务器支持HTTPS 服务器不支持HTTPS
SSL证书安装正确 SSL证书安装并验证成功 SSL证书未安装或验证失败

四、代码编写与数据交互

1. 使用微信开发工具进行代码编写

在代码编写阶段,选择微信提供的开发工具是非常关键的。微信开发工具提供了丰富的API接口和调试工具,使得开发者可以更高效地进行小程序开发。以下是一些代码编写的基本步骤:

  1. 搭建开发环境:下载并安装微信开发者工具,配置相应的开发环境,如小程序目录结构、开发者账号等信息。
  2. 创建页面结构:使用HTML、CSS等前端技术搭建页面结构,确保页面布局合理,用户体验良好。
  3. 编写JavaScript逻辑:通过JavaScript实现页面交互、数据处理等功能,使小程序具备功能性。
  4. 使用微信API:合理运用微信提供的API,实现扫码登录、微信支付等功能。

2. 实现网站与小程序数据交互的方法

网站与小程序之间的数据交互是实现二者整合的关键。以下是一些常见的交互方法:

  1. API调用:通过微信小程序提供的API,如微信支付、用户信息获取等,实现网站与小程序之间的数据交互。
  2. WebSocket通信:使用WebSocket实现双向通信,使小程序实时接收网站推送的数据。
  3. 消息推送:利用微信消息推送功能,将网站信息实时推送至小程序。

3. 代码优化与调试技巧

在代码编写过程中,优化和调试是提高小程序性能的重要环节。以下是一些优化和调试技巧:

  1. 代码优化:遵循良好的编程规范,如代码模块化、变量命名规范等,提高代码可读性和可维护性。
  2. 性能优化:关注小程序的运行效率,如减少页面加载时间、优化图片资源等。
  3. 调试工具:利用微信开发者工具的调试功能,如断点调试、查看网络请求等,帮助开发者快速定位问题。
  4. 版本控制:使用版本控制系统(如Git)管理代码,方便代码备份和版本回滚。

通过以上步骤,开发者可以高效地完成代码编写、数据交互及优化调试工作,从而确保网站接入小程序的顺利进行。

五、提交审核与发布

1、提交审核的流程

在完成小程序的代码编写和测试后,开发者需将小程序提交至微信审核平台。以下是提交审核的基本流程:

  1. 登录微信小程序管理后台,选择“提交审核”。
  2. 填写小程序的基本信息,包括名称、介绍、功能描述等。
  3. 上传小程序截图,展示小程序的主要功能界面。
  4. 选择审核类型,如首次提交、更新等。
  5. 检查所有信息无误后,提交审核申请。

2、审核注意事项

为确保审核通过,开发者需注意以下几点:

  • 确保小程序内容符合微信平台规范,不得涉及违法、违规内容。
  • 小程序功能完整,界面美观,用户体验良好。
  • 提供详细的功能描述和截图,方便审核人员了解小程序。
  • 提交审核时,确保所有信息准确无误。

3、发布后的维护与更新

小程序发布后,开发者需定期进行维护和更新,以保证用户体验。以下是一些维护和更新的建议:

  • 关注用户反馈,及时修复小程序中的问题和bug。
  • 根据用户需求,不断优化小程序功能和界面。
  • 定期更新小程序,增加新功能和内容。
  • 关注行业动态,了解最新的小程序发展趋势。

结语

网站接入小程序的关键步骤在于:首先注册微信小程序账号,获取AppID;其次,嵌入小程序API并配置服务器域名,确保HTTPS支持;接着,使用微信开发工具进行代码编写,实现网站与小程序的数据交互;最后,提交审核并发布,注重维护与更新。通过这一系列操作,企业不仅能提升用户体验,还能拓展业务,实现线上线下的深度融合。我们鼓励读者积极尝试,让小程序成为推动网站发展的新引擎。

常见问题

1、小程序注册失败怎么办?

如果您在注册小程序时遇到失败,首先检查填写的信息是否准确无误。若信息无误,可能是因为当前注册量已满或存在系统错误。您可以尝试稍后再试,或联系微信客服寻求帮助。

2、API嵌入后无法正常工作如何解决?

API嵌入后无法正常工作,可能是以下原因导致的:

  • API版本不兼容
  • 代码编写错误
  • 缺少必要的权限

解决方法:

  • 确保使用与小程序版本兼容的API版本
  • 仔细检查代码,查找并修复错误
  • 确保开发者已获得必要的权限

3、服务器域名配置常见错误及解决方法

服务器域名配置常见错误包括:

  • 域名解析错误
  • 证书过期
  • HTTPS配置错误

解决方法:

  • 检查域名解析设置,确保解析到正确的IP地址
  • 更新证书,确保证书有效
  • 仔细检查HTTPS配置,确保正确设置

4、代码编写过程中常见问题及调试技巧

代码编写过程中常见问题包括:

  • 变量未定义
  • 语法错误
  • 逻辑错误

调试技巧:

  • 使用调试工具逐步执行代码,观察变量值的变化
  • 使用日志输出,跟踪代码执行过程
  • 仔细检查代码逻辑,确保正确实现功能

5、审核不通过的原因及应对策略

审核不通过的原因可能包括:

  • 小程序功能不完善
  • 内容违规
  • 用户体验不佳

应对策略:

  • 仔细阅读审核指南,确保小程序符合要求
  • 优化小程序功能,提升用户体验
  • 及时修改违规内容,避免再次被拒绝审核

原创文章,作者:路飞练拳的地方,如若转载,请注明出处:https://www.shuziqianzhan.com/article/46452.html

Like (0)
路飞练拳的地方的头像路飞练拳的地方研究员
Previous 2025-06-10 03:26
Next 2025-06-10 03:27

相关推荐

  • 百度商桥怎么获取代码

    要获取百度商桥代码,首先登录百度商桥官网,进入管理中心。选择需要绑定的网站,点击“获取代码”按钮,系统会生成一段JavaScript代码。将这段代码复制并粘贴到网站页面的标签内,确保所有页面都能加载此代码,即可完成安装。

    2025-06-16
    0140
  • 网站搜索引擎排名怎么查

    要查看网站在搜索引擎中的排名,可以使用工具如Google Search Console或第三方SEO工具如Ahrefs、SEMrush。输入网站域名和目标关键词,这些工具会显示网站在搜索引擎结果页(SERP)中的具体位置。此外,手动搜索关键词并查看网站排名也是一种直接方法,但效率较低。

    2025-06-16
    074
  • 如何利用负债节税

    利用负债节税的关键在于合理规划债务结构。首先,选择低利率贷款,如房贷、车贷,通过利息支出抵扣应纳税所得额。其次,确保债务用途与生产经营相关,以便更有效地享受税前扣除。最后,咨询专业税务顾问,制定个性化节税方案,确保合规合法。

  • 网页用什么切图

    网页切图通常使用Photoshop、Illustrator等图像处理软件,确保图片质量和兼容性。也可以选择在线工具如Figma、Canva,便捷高效。切图时需考虑图片格式(如PNG、JPEG),优化加载速度和显示效果。

    2025-06-20
    0189
  • 微信商城网站怎么做的

    微信商城网站建设首先需注册微信小程序账号,选择适合的电商平台模板或定制开发。利用微信提供的API接口,整合支付、物流等功能。重视用户体验,设计简洁易用的界面,确保加载速度。定期更新商品信息,优化SEO,提升搜索排名。

    2025-06-17
    0162
  • dede怎么调用留言板

    要在DedeCMS中调用留言板,首先需要确保安装了留言板模块。然后,在模板文件中插入调用代码:{dede:guestbook},并设置相关参数,如显示条数、排序方式等。通过这种方式,即可在前端页面展示留言板内容,便于用户互动。

    2025-06-10
    02
  • abc网站建设怎么样

    abc网站建设以其高效性和专业性著称,提供定制化解决方案,满足不同企业需求。其强大的技术团队确保网站安全稳定,用户体验优良。SEO优化功能更是助力企业提升在线可见度,值得信赖。

    2025-06-17
    0173
  • 空间如何开通伪静态

    开通伪静态能有效提升网站访问速度和SEO表现。首先,登录网站服务器,找到配置文件(如Apache的.htaccess或Nginx的nginx.conf)。然后,添加相应的伪静态规则,例如在Apache中可写入RewriteEngine On和RewriteRule指令。最后,保存并重启服务器使配置生效。注意备份原文件,避免配置错误。

  • 网页中的作用是什么

    网页在互联网中扮演着信息展示和交互的核心角色。它不仅是内容的载体,还通过HTML、CSS和JavaScript等技术实现用户交互,提升用户体验。网页能够展示文字、图片、视频等多媒体内容,帮助企业进行品牌宣传、产品展示,并通过SEO优化吸引更多访问量,提升网站排名。

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注